paia

Posted on April 11, 2020 by bahasasula_3n5une

‘papaya’
e.g. (1) paia kau ‘papaya tree’ (2) paia fua ‘papaya fruit’ (3) paia hal ‘papaya blossom’ source: Duwila; Fagudu Tribe, Waibao village 2015 note: loan from Carib via Spanish, Portugese, Malay
